Output be7520356092960e5e4034349189ac9c380e3be6688c4a0378b344fcc338327a:1074

value
2584656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ca1a091af709cb07aad23e1a0bc7f0055bf82cd7 OP_EQUALVERIFY OP_CHECKSIG
address
LdeZwwoe7EqX4XmqzDtrbmNWcQQq23Xibb
transaction
be7520356092960e5e4034349189ac9c380e3be6688c4a0378b344fcc338327a
spent
true